Risks and Management After Stopping Mounjaro (Tirzepatide)
When stopping tirzepatide, the primary risks include loss of glycemic control and weight regain, with glucose levels typically returning toward baseline within 2-3 weeks due to its 5-day half-life, though no specific withdrawal syndrome or acute adverse events are documented in the literature. 1
Pharmacokinetic Considerations
- Tirzepatide has an elimination half-life of approximately 5 days, meaning the medication will be substantially cleared from the body within 2-3 weeks after the last dose 1
- The medication's effects on gastric emptying and glucose control will gradually diminish as drug levels decline 2
- No evidence exists for acute withdrawal symptoms or rebound effects specific to tirzepatide discontinuation 1
Primary Risks After Discontinuation
Glycemic Deterioration
- Expect rapid loss of glycemic control within 2-4 weeks after stopping, as tirzepatide provides very high efficacy glucose lowering 3
- Patients previously well-controlled on tirzepatide may experience A1C increases of 1-2% or more if no alternative therapy is initiated 3
- The dual GIP/GLP-1 receptor agonism provides potent glucose lowering that will be lost upon discontinuation 4, 5
Weight Regain
- Significant weight regain is expected, as tirzepatide produces the highest weight loss efficacy among approved diabetes medications (mean weight loss >20% in clinical trials) 3
- Weight management benefits cease when the medication is stopped, with gradual return toward baseline weight 3
Loss of Cardiometabolic Benefits
- For patients with established atherosclerotic cardiovascular disease (ASCVD), heart failure, or chronic kidney disease, discontinuation removes important protective effects 3
- GLP-1 receptor agonists (the GLP-1 component of tirzepatide) have demonstrated cardiovascular and kidney benefits that will be lost 3
Management Strategies
Immediate Transition Planning
- Do not delay medication intensification or substitution—clinical inertia worsens outcomes 3
- Initiate alternative glucose-lowering therapy before or immediately upon discontinuation to prevent glycemic deterioration 3
Medication Substitution Algorithm
For patients with ASCVD, heart failure, or CKD:
- Transition to an SGLT2 inhibitor and/or GLP-1 receptor agonist with proven cardiovascular benefit, independent of A1C level 3
- These agents should be prioritized even if switching from tirzepatide, as they provide organ protection beyond glucose lowering 3
For patients without cardiovascular/kidney disease:
- Base medication choice on glycemic efficacy needed, weight management goals, hypoglycemia risk, and cost/access 3
- Consider high-efficacy alternatives: semaglutide (GLP-1 RA), dulaglutide high-dose, or insulin if severe hyperglycemia develops 3
- Metformin should be continued or initiated if not contraindicated (eGFR ≥30 mL/min/1.73 m²) 3
If cost is the reason for discontinuation:
- Consider lower-cost options: metformin, sulfonylureas, thiazolidinediones, or human insulin, while acknowledging trade-offs in hypoglycemia risk and weight effects 3
- Work with social services to address financial barriers before discontinuing effective therapy 3
Monitoring Requirements
- Check fasting glucose and A1C within 4-8 weeks of discontinuation to assess glycemic status 3
- Monitor for symptoms of hyperglycemia (polyuria, polydipsia, unexplained weight loss) 3
- Assess weight trajectory at follow-up visits 3
Special Perioperative Considerations
Gastric Emptying Normalization
- Tirzepatide delays gastric emptying, which may increase pulmonary aspiration risk during anesthesia 3, 2
- With a 5-day half-life, gastric emptying effects should substantially resolve within 2-3 weeks after the last dose 1
- Inform anesthesia providers of recent tirzepatide use even if discontinued, particularly if stopped within 3 weeks of a procedure 3, 2
Common Pitfalls to Avoid
- Never stop tirzepatide without a transition plan—the medication provides very high glucose-lowering efficacy that will be immediately lost 3
- Do not assume patients can maintain control with lifestyle modifications alone after stopping such a potent agent 3
- Avoid delaying insulin initiation if severe hyperglycemia develops (glucose ≥300 mg/dL or A1C ≥10%) 3
- Do not overlook the need for cardiovascular/kidney protective medications in high-risk patients when transitioning therapy 3
Vitamin B12 Monitoring
- If transitioning to metformin, consider periodic vitamin B12 level monitoring, especially in patients with anemia or peripheral neuropathy 3
